Sovanny Kon Ebbesen began her tenure at Lehman on January 5, 2017. A native of North Pole, Alaska, Ebbesen was a standout performer in high school before moving onto play volleyball at the University of Alaska Fairbanks. A defensive specialist, Ebbesen was a four year letter winner and captain her final two seasons for the Nanooks. A 1995 graduate, Ebbesen holds a B.A. in both Economics and Business Administration.

This past season, Ebbesen was the Assistant Volleyball Coach at Williston State College in Williston, ND. Her Teton squad ended the season with a record of 18-17. In this role she developed practice plans for Individual practice sessions, training and conditioning, overseeing student academic progress, recruitment, game strategy, skills development and administrative duties. Before moving to the college ranks, Ebbesen, was the varsity coach at Lathrop High School in Fairbanks. While there she posted a mark of 112-19 including four regional championships in her six seasons at the helm.
During her tenure as a high school coach she also was the head coach for the Alaska Junior Volleyball Club where she guided the U16s while being the club administration for girls ages 11-18.
